What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ach?

The average price of all flights from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
If you are looking for a flight deal from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ach, look for departures on Tuesdays and avoid leaving on a Thursday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Myrtle Beach, Tuesday is the cheapest day to fly and Monday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ach is October, where tickets cost $280 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are March and April, where the average cost of tickets is $463 and $428 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ach, you should book around 4 days before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 16 days before departure.

How long does a flight from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ach take?

There are no direct flights for this route. The shortest travel duration to get to Myrtle Beach from Milwaukee is 4h 26m.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Milwaukee and Myrtle Beach?

    No, a passport isn't needed to fly from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ach. However, local authorities might ask for an official ID.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ach?

    Milwaukee and Myrtle Beach are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Milwaukee from Milwaukee-Mitchell and will be arriving at Myrtle Beach Intl.

  • What is the most popular layover when flying to Myrtle Beach from Milwaukee?

    Charlotte is the most popular layover city among KAYAK users traveling from Milwaukee to Myrtle Beach.
